Le 05/11/2010 15:52, Matthieu CERDA a écrit :
> Hello,
>
> I noticed that when you create a directory named "repos" in the
> masterfiles CF3 directory, having a freshly bootstrapped (not modified
> yet) environment, it makes the default promises set halt with :
>
> --- BEGIN CODE ---
> r...@mcerda-deb-vm3:/var/cfengine/inputs# cf-agent -I -K
> /var/cfengine/inputs/repos is not a plain file
> File /var/cfengine/inputs/repos was marked for editing but could not be
> opened
> I: Report relates to a promise with handle ""
> I: Made in version 'not specified' of '/var/cfengine/inputs/site.cf'
> near line 81
> I: Comment: Check if there are still promises about cfengine 2 that need
> removing
>
> /var/cfengine/inputs/repos is not a plain file
> File /var/cfengine/inputs/repos was marked for editing but could not be
> opened
> I: Report relates to a promise with handle ""
> I: Made in version 'not specified' of '/var/cfengine/inputs/site.cf'
> near line 81
> I: Comment: Check if there are still promises about cfengine 2 that need
> removing
>
> /var/cfengine/inputs/repos is not a plain file
> File /var/cfengine/inputs/repos was marked for editing but could not be
> opened
> I: Report relates to a promise with handle ""
> I: Made in version 'not specified' of '/var/cfengine/inputs/site.cf'
> near line 81
> I: Comment: Check if there are still promises about cfengine 2 that need
> removing
>
> r...@mcerda-deb-vm3:/var/cfengine/inputs#
> --- END CODE ---
>
> site.cf line 81 is all about compatibility with CF2 files, so it should
> not make things go boom like that.
>
> I'm using CF3 trunk 1475, on a debian squeeze/testing virtual machine.
>
> Is it a known issue, promise quirk or CF3 bug ?
>
> Regards,
>
>    
I noticed that whatever you do with directories, it seems have trouble 
when you create more than one directory on masterfiles. I tested with 
masterfiles/d1/d2, d1 and d2 in masterfiles.

-- 
==========================================
Matthieu CERDA
------------------------------------------
Normation
44 rue Cauchy, 94110 Arcueil, France
------------------------------------------
Telephone:  +33 (0)1 83 62 26 96
Mobile:     +33 (0)6 30 53 40 00
------------------------------------------
Web:        http://www.normation.com/
==========================================

_______________________________________________
Help-cfengine mailing list
Help-cfengine@cfengine.org
https://cfengine.org/mailman/listinfo/help-cfengine

Reply via email to